redis簡單教程
相關Redis是一種高性能的開源鍵值存儲系統(tǒng),它支持多種數(shù)據(jù)結構,并提供了豐富的操作命令,可以用于解決大量互聯(lián)網(wǎng)應用中的緩存、隊列、發(fā)布訂閱等問題。本文將從以下幾個方面介紹Redis的基本概念、安裝配
相關
Redis是一種高性能的開源鍵值存儲系統(tǒng),它支持多種數(shù)據(jù)結構,并提供了豐富的操作命令,可以用于解決大量互聯(lián)網(wǎng)應用中的緩存、隊列、發(fā)布訂閱等問題。本文將從以下幾個方面介紹Redis的基本概念、安裝配置、數(shù)據(jù)類型、操作命令和實戰(zhàn)案例。
1. Redis的基本概念
- 介紹Redis的起源和發(fā)展,以及其與傳統(tǒng)關系型數(shù)據(jù)庫的比較。
- 解釋Redis的主要特點,包括內存存儲、高性能、持久化和分布式架構等。
2. 安裝與配置
- 提供Redis的安裝方法和配置文件的詳細說明。
- 指導讀者如何在不同操作系統(tǒng)上安裝和啟動Redis,并修改配置文件以滿足自己的需求。
3. 數(shù)據(jù)類型
- 介紹Redis支持的數(shù)據(jù)類型,包括字符串、哈希、列表、集合和有序集合。
- 每種數(shù)據(jù)類型都詳細解釋了其特點和常用命令,并給出了應用場景的示例。
4. 操作命令
- 分類介紹Redis的常用操作命令,包括數(shù)據(jù)的增刪改查、事務處理、過期時間設置等。
- 通過簡單明了的示例代碼,讓讀者能夠快速掌握Redis的基本操作技巧。
5. 實戰(zhàn)案例
- 針對實際應用場景,提供了一些Redis的實戰(zhàn)案例,如使用Redis作為緩存解決方案、使用Redis實現(xiàn)分布式鎖等。
- 每個案例都給出了詳細的步驟和代碼示例,幫助讀者理解并應用Redis的強大功能。
通過本文的學習,讀者將能夠全面了解Redis的基本知識和使用方法,并能夠應用于自己的項目中。無論是初學者還是有一定經驗的開發(fā)者,都能從本文中獲得實用的知識和技巧,提升自己的技術水平。